Noise

Laundry days can be stressful when you have to clean up dirty sports gear and dirty PE kits for the kids, as well as bedding changes for your dogs. The last thing you need is a noisy washer to add to that stress.

During normal operation, most washers emit sound levels ranging from 40 to 80 decibels. Anything lower than 50 decibels can be considered quiet. 50 decibels is the sound of a quiet discussion. It is important to keep in mind that the sound level of a washer during the spin cycle will likely be louder than the wash cycle.

Quiet washers typically have things like brushed motors, which produce less friction than traditional rotary motors, and therefore make less noise. They could also have internal insulation that helps reduce the vibrations that could transfer to floors and furniture during high spin speeds.

The level of noise produced by washing machines can depend on the program it is running. For instance it's typically much quieter when washing delicates than a heavy cotton load.
